STECK -- read once and referred to the Committee on Education AN ACT to amend the education law, in relation to residency requirements for charter schools The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em- bly, do enact as follows: 1 Section 1. Paragraph (b) of subdivision 2 of section 2854 of the 2 education law, as amended by section 3 of subpart A of part B of chapter 3 20 of the laws of 2015, is amended to read as follows: 4 (b) Any child who is qualified under the laws of this state for admis- 5 sion to a public school is qualified for admission to a charter school, 6 provided that such child lives in the local school district in which the 7 charter school is located. Applications for admission to a charter 8 school shall be submitted on a uniform application form created by the 9 department and shall be made available by a charter school in languages 10 predominately spoken in the community in which such charter school is 11 located. The school shall enroll each eligible student who submits a 12 timely application by the first day of April each year, unless the 13 number of applications exceeds the capacity of the grade level or build- 14 ing. In such cases, students shall be accepted from among applicants by 15 a random selection process, provided, however, that an enrollment pref- 16 erence shall be provided to pupils returning to the charter school in 17 the second or any subsequent year of operation and pupils residing in 18 the school district in which the charter school is located, and siblings 19 of pupils already enrolled in the charter school. Preference may also be 20 provided to children of employees of the charter school or charter 21 management organization, provided that such children of employees may 22 constitute no more than fifteen percent of the charter school's total 23 enrollment.
